Transaction 668aa7722e8eb4e813c1307bcc0e9e7285d8d0534f6a02784cc2f8230d385abe
1 Input
1 Output
-
668aa7722e8eb4e813c1307bcc0e9e7285d8d0534f6a02784cc2f8230d385abe:0
- value
- 2013816
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a8f380008877eca5f122be519d6eb5e965a0dc2
- address
- bc1q328nsqqgsalv5hcj90j3n4htt6t95rwz49wj3p